Castelo de Guimarães, Guimarães

castelo-de-guimaraes 

Castelo de Guimarães is an icon of our history, being designated as the birthplace of Portugal, and the birthplace of the first King of Portugal, D. Afonso Henriques. This Castle dates to the 9th century and it’s linked to the foundation of Condado Portucalense and to the struggles for independence of Portugal. Castelo de Óbidos, Leiria

castelo-de-obidos 

Located in Santa Maria, Castelo de Óbidos dates to the 12th century, eventually suffering a lot of damage to the structure with the 1755 earthquake. The castle and the entire urban complex of the town of Óbidos are classified as a national monument. In 1932 Castelo de Óbidos went through a consolidation, reconstruction and restoration interventions. From this set, the town's pillory stands out, built in granite; also, the town's aqueduct and the Memory Cross. Mosteiro da Batalha, Leiria

 mosteiro-da-batalha

Formerly designated by Mosteiro Santa Maria da Vitória, Mosteiro da Batalha is known for Templo da Pátria. This monastery of the Ordem de São Domingos was built over two centuries until around 1563, during the reign of seven kings of Portugal. It represents Portuguese Gothic architecture and was considered a world heritage site by UNESCO. Mosteiro de Alcobaça, Leiria

 mosteiro-de-alcobaca

Mosteiro de Alcobaça is also known as Mosteiro Real Santa Maria de Alcobaça, a totally Gothic work with the beginning of construction in 1178. It’s classified as a World Heritage Site by UNESCO since 1989 and as a Portuguese National Monument since 1910. Mosteiro dos Jerónimos, Lisboa

 mosteiro-dos-jeronimos

Mosteiro dos Jerónimos dates to the end of the 15th century, where it was built by King Manuel I. With the status of National Pantheon since 2016, it is located in the parish of Belém, in the city of Lisbon. Through Manuelina architecture, this monastery is the most illustrious Portuguese monastic complex of its time. Mosteiro dos Jerónimos has been classified as a National Monument since 1907 and, in 1983, it was classified as a World Heritage Site by UNESCO. Palácio Nacional da Pena, Sintra

 palacio-da-pena 

Palácio Nacional da Pena, popularly referred to as Palácio da Pena or Castelo da Pena is located in the village of Sintra, in the Lisbon district. It represents one of the main expressions of 19th century architectural Romanticism in the world, constituting the first palace in this style in Europe. Torre de Belém, Lisboa

torre-de-belem 

Torre de Belém, formerly Torre de São Vicente a Par de Belém, and now officially Torre de São Vicente, is a monument located in Belém, Lisbon. It represents one of the ex-libris of the city, being an architectural icon of the reign of D. Manuel I. The monument is a tribute to nationalism, through the decorations of the Coat of Arms of Portugal, including inscriptions of crosses of the Order of Christ in the windows of stronghold. Both Mosteiro dos Jerónimos and Torre de Belém, it was classified in 1983 as a UNESCO World Heritage Site!
